STOCKS DJDE

Identifies the stock set and its associated stock(s) to be used in a
report. This stockset file (STOCKSETNAME.STK) must already
have been created by a compiled JSL and must currently reside
in the “lcds” resource folder on the system disk.

Type

Page oriented

Syntax

STOCKS = stocksetname

Options

STOCKS DJDE: point to note

Whenever a new stockset is chosen, that is, at start of report or
through a JDE or JDL switch via DJDE, the system verifies each
stock to determine that the stock exists and can be made active.
This verification provides an automatic method of changing
stocks in the printer as required by the data stream.

TMODE DJDE

Specifies a maximum paper width in order to improve throughput
efficiency when using mixed paper sizes. (Refer to the OUTPUT
TMODE parameter description in the “Specifying print format
parameters” chapter, for an explanation of pitch mode.)

Type

Page oriented

Syntax

TMODE = (width [, widthunit])
